A Call to Courage Sin’s Path… I SAW the plunder I COVETED it I TOOK it I HID it

A Call to Courage Have you ever found yourself in a similar situation? Are you on this pathway today? SIN IS SERIOUS and unless we take it seriously it has serious consequences!

A Call to Courage So why is Sin so serious? 1.Individual/personal SIN is serious because it affects the whole body/community

A Call to Courage So why is Sin so serious? 2. Sin is very serious because of the CONSEQUENCES

A Call to Courage In Romans 6:23 it says, For the wages of sin is death, but the gift of God is eternal life in Christ Jesus our Lord. 1 John 2: 1 My dear children, I write this to you so that you will not sin. But if anybody does sin, we have an advocate with the Father—Jesus Christ, the Righteous One. 2 He is the atoning sacrifice for our sins, and not only for ours but also for the sins of the whole world.

A Call to Courage So what? What has this got to do with me? Why should I deal with my sin today? 1.Your life depends upon it! John 1:12 Yet to all who did receive him, to those who believed in his name, he gave the right to become children of God—

A Call to Courage 2. If you are a Christ Follower who is willingly and deliberately living in SIN you are not experiencing God’s best for you.

A Call to Courage 3. I’m also convinced that your SINS will eventually find you out! Numbers 32:23 “But if you fail to do this, you will be sinning against the LORD? and you may be sure that your sin will find you out.
